cobrowsing-decorators is a confirmed malicious npm package (MAL-2026-12653) that executes malicious code on install (malicious version 35.2.9). Do not install it — remove it immediately and rotate any exposed credentials.
Malicious code in cobrowsing-decorators (npm)
What this malware does
On require/import, index.js unconditionally loads bootstrap.js, which selects a platform-specific asset path, fetches an opaque binary from string-concatenation-obfuscated Cloudflare Workers endpoints (oob-worker.cf101-adf.workers.dev, oob-worker.cf99-9b3.workers.dev, oob-worker.cf103-070.workers.dev, oob-worker.cf100-416.workers.dev) with a DNS TXT fallback to sdk.dl.wel1.ru / ext.dl.wel1.ru / pkg.dl.wel1.ru / net.dl.wel1.ru, writes it to a disguised temp filename (dotnet_diag*.exe,.analytics_state), chmods it 0755 on POSIX, and spawns it detached via /bin/sh -c or cmd. No signature or hash verification is performed and the payload has no relationship to the package's declared 'cobrowsing decorators' purpose. lib/telemetry.js (81 KB, framed as an 'Analytics SDK') replicates the same dropper primitives — base64 chunk assembly, fs.chmodSync to 0755 via string-concatenated method name, and detached cp.spawn('/bin/sh', ['-c', filePath + ' &']) — providing a redundant execution path. Endpoint hostnames and fallback domains are assembled by joining fragmented substrings to evade plain-string review.

If you installed it — respond
Remove cobrowsing-decorators from your project and lockfile, then assume any secrets accessible to the build or runtime were exposed: rotate API keys, tokens, and credentials, and audit for unexpected outbound activity or persistence.
